SDCL § 23A-10A-13.1 — Restoration to competency program defined

The term, restoration to competency program, as used in this chapter, means a program under the direction of an approved facility which is designed to restore the defendant to competency in an inpatient, outpatient, or jail-based setting. The term includes a county jail upon the concurrence of the county sheriff to provide restoration to competency in the jail under the direction of an approved facility.
